Output 3c265ab69ecaf0a59b0e56f3d6a0b3a9c4725b40d4fe1e9dc986ab3be64139d4:3

value
508425305
script pubkey
OP_0 OP_PUSHBYTES_20 70b28506556312d261dc1d90df49d1b9dd0f0a2b
address
tb1qwzeg2pj4vvfdycwurkgd7jw3h8ws7z3tf0jqnd
transaction
3c265ab69ecaf0a59b0e56f3d6a0b3a9c4725b40d4fe1e9dc986ab3be64139d4